Veľký Kamenec (Former name, before 1948: Veľký Kevežd; Hungarian: Nagykövesd) is a village and commune in Trebišov District, Košice Region of eastern Slovakia.
History[]
In historical records the village was first mentioned in 1280.
Geography[]
The village lies at an altitude of 124 metres and covers an area of 12.723 km². It has a population of about 835 people.
Ethnicity[]
The village is about 89% Hungarian 10% Slovak and 1% Gypsy, Czech and Ukrainian.
Facilities[]
The village has a public library and a football pitch
